Kay channels Sterling’s iconic call to honor the late John Sterling

TL;DR Summary
Michael Kay honored the late John Sterling by mimicking Sterling’s iconic home-run call for Aaron Judge during the Yankees’ win over the Orioles, a tribute marked by hats with JS, a moment of silence, and Kay’s emotional reflection on Sterling’s impact and his wish to walk his daughter down the aisle.
